Hiring a contractor could be a daunting task, especially when contemplating the multitude of options and elements concerned. A well-structured contractor hiring information can help simplify the process and make certain that you make your greatest option in your project. Understanding the important steps and issues can lay a powerful foundation for a successful collaboration.






The first step in any hiring process is defining your project scope. Clearly identifying what you need can save time and eliminate misunderstandings down the line. This includes determining the sort of work to be accomplished, the specified timeline, and your budget. By having a detailed define of your expectations, you equip your self and potential contractors with the required data for knowledgeable discussions.


Next, doing thorough analysis is crucial. Online assets, recommendations from associates or household, and native trade associations can provide useful insights into reputable contractors in your area. Professional reviews and portfolio examples can also aid in assessing a contractor's experience and quality of labor. When looking out, look for people who concentrate on your specific type of project to ensure they possess the related data and expertise.

Once you might have a list of potential contractors, the next step is reaching out for initial consultations. Most contractors shall be willing to fulfill with you to discuss the project and supply an estimate. During these consultations, ask questions about their expertise, earlier tasks, and work style. This dialogue can help gauge whether or not there’s an excellent fit in terms of communication and values.

It’s additionally wise to request references from previous purchasers. Speaking directly to past prospects can provide deeper insight into the contractor's reliability, work ethic, and total quality. Ask about timelines, adherence to budget, and how they dealt with any challenges that arose during the project.


Additionally, understanding the contractor's licensing and insurance coverage standing is important. A licensed contractor signifies that they meet the mandatory regulations and standards in your space. Insurance protects you from potential liabilities, guaranteeing that any mishaps or accidents on-site will not leave you financially responsible. This step is non-negotiable and ought to be completely verified earlier than any contracts are signed.

As you slender down your choices, consider obtaining a quantity of bids. Having a quantity of estimates can offer a clearer picture of the market price in your project and assist identify any outliers. However, be cautious when comparing bids. The lowest estimate might not at all times characterize the best value. Assess each bid by means of the scope of labor, materials proposed, and the contractor's qualifications.


Once you've got selected a contractor, the subsequent step is formalizing the settlement. A clear, written contract ought to define every aspect of the work, together with begin and finish dates, fee schedules, and what to expect by means of progress updates. Ensure all phrases are explicitly acknowledged, and both parties understand their responsibilities.


Communication is a vital facet of any project involving contractors. Establishing expectations for regular check-ins can help keep you knowledgeable of progress and handle any issues promptly. Good communication not only fosters a smoother workflow but in addition builds trust between you and the contractor, in the end contributing to a profitable project outcome.


Throughout the project, be proactive in monitoring progress. Regularly visiting the site and maintaining an open line of communication with the contractor will allow you to keep informed of developments. If any issues come up, addressing them promptly can stop misunderstandings and problems later.
